From 9fbe11738d77c92a1af887498f00bb7851da7125 Mon Sep 17 00:00:00 2001 From: Edric <EckoEdc@users.noreply.github.com> Date: Mon, 15 Feb 2016 11:33:35 -0500 Subject: [PATCH] Remove int/unsigned int comparison warning --- include/opendht/dht.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/include/opendht/dht.h b/include/opendht/dht.h index 8fed6bcc..87fb3fdb 100644 --- a/include/opendht/dht.h +++ b/include/opendht/dht.h @@ -69,7 +69,7 @@ struct Node { Node(const InfoHash& id, const sockaddr* sa, socklen_t salen) : id(id), ss(), sslen(salen) { std::copy_n((const uint8_t*)sa, salen, (uint8_t*)&ss); - if (salen < sizeof(ss)) + if ((unsigned)salen < sizeof(ss)) std::fill_n((uint8_t*)&ss+salen, sizeof(ss)-salen, 0); } InfoHash getId() const { -- GitLab